Post angioplasty you will be taking anti-platelets, which can cause minor bleeding issues. It depends on the procedure and the operating surgeon whether they require stopping anti-platelets or can safely carry out the procedure on these medications. If required the dentist can ask to hold these medicines for 2 to 3 days prior to the procedure and restart the drugs as soon as the procedure is over. The procedure can be safely done so do not worry.
